As of August 2025, in the Cloud Backup category, the mindshare of Synology C2 Backup is 1.6%, up from 0.6% compared to the previous year. The mindshare of Veeam Data Platform is 13.6%, down from 17.3% compared to the previous year. It is calculated based on PeerSpot user engagement data.

Provides fast access to files and offers a reliable backup solution without compatibility issues
Versioning control helps speed up data recovery by providing easy access to previous versions of files. This is particularly useful when moving backups to off-site storage and deploying them quickly during installations. My experience with Synology Backup's security features includes partitioning for production environments, regular scans for new threats, and support for multifactor authentication. Password security is also emphasized, meeting basic security requirements. Before choosing Synology, consider its sensitivity in your network infrastructure, especially for critical backup and storage tasks. Prioritize security, including testing and recovery procedures, and evaluate the device's performance to ensure it meets your needs effectively. Overall, I would rate Synology C2 Backup as an eight out of ten.
